Technology Veteran Joins Coke Florida Leadership Team

Guillermo Mora to help build Coke Florida’s supply chain automation capabilities

TAMPA, Fla.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Coca-Cola Beverages Florida, LLC (“Coke Florida”) announces Guillermo Mora has joined the company as Senior Director, Supply Chain and Logistics Technology.

An industry veteran with deep expertise in both the operations and technology sides of Supply Chain and Logistics, Guillermo’s career has been rooted in the Retail and Consumer Packaged Goods sector. He most recently served as Director of Delivery at o9 Solutions, leading the implementation of retail allocation and merchandise financial planning systems for multi-billion-dollar clients. Guillermo also spent nearly a decade at Under Armour, where he held multiple leadership roles, including Director of IT, Business Partner.

He holds a Bachelor of Business Administration in Supply Chain Management from California State University, Long Beach.

Gerald Charles Jr, Coke Florida’s Senior Vice President, Chief Information Officer shared, “I am excited to welcome Guillermo to the Coke Florida team. His experience on both the operations and technology sides will help us in building scalable technology roadmaps in close collaboration with key ecosystem partners – critical skills in achieving the enterprise capability we need to deliver profitable growth.”

As the Florida Coca-Cola bottler, Coke Florida’s supply chain and logistics footprint includes 4 manufacturing facilities and 18 distribution operations. “I'm excited to join Coca-Cola Florida at such a pivotal time for supply chain innovation. Leveraging advanced Supply Chain technology, we have a tremendous opportunity to enhance efficiency, resilience, and service across our network. I look forward to driving digital transformation that supports our teams, strengthens our partnerships, and ensures we deliver excellence to customers and communities across Florida,” said Mora.

About Coca-Cola Beverages Florida, LLC

Coca-Cola Beverages Florida, LLC (Coke Florida) is the sixth largest Coca-Cola bottler in the United States. Coke Florida makes, sells, and distributes products of The Coca-Cola Company in an exclusive territory that covers over 21 million consumers across 47 counties in Florida. The company employs over 5,000 associates and operates four GreenCircle Certified manufacturing facilities and eighteen distribution centers. Founded in 2015 and headquartered in Tampa, Coke Florida is one of the largest Black-owned businesses in the United States. In 2025, Coke Florida was recognized as a US Best Managed Company Gold Standard Winner by Deloitte Private and The Wall Street Journal. To learn more, visit www.cokeflorida.com.
